Output 0883ecd783d936344a2b33f8756c31fef283f8a3d272912eabf56f4fbca127bb:0

value
120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df8b1a10e85d9a52e971aeb29adf12260e81289c OP_EQUAL
address
3N51FHXu1miKVscXduhHHMr9H6iD7ngVpo
transaction
0883ecd783d936344a2b33f8756c31fef283f8a3d272912eabf56f4fbca127bb
confirmations
298233
spent
true